Meaning ● Customer Empathy Automation (CEA) in the SMB context strategically applies technology to understand and respond to customer emotions at scale. It’s about leveraging tools like sentiment analysis on customer feedback to personalize interactions, thus mimicking genuine empathy even with limited resources. ● CEA is a process where automated systems capture and analyze customer feelings, enabling SMBs to tailor their responses proactively. In effect, SMBs can address frustrations, answer questions, and predict future needs, often improving customer loyalty while optimizing operational costs. ● Implementation for an SMB might involve using a CRM with built-in sentiment analysis or a dedicated customer feedback platform. This allows small teams to monitor customer sentiment, identify areas for improvement, and personalize service delivery in a consistent manner. The end game is business growth: a happier customer is a more loyal and vocal customer. This word-of-mouth is invaluable in SMB expansion. ● Crucially, CEA balances automation with personalization; automated actions driven by customer understanding, rather than just efficient task completion. This is crucial for creating authentic interactions that improve customer retention and drive sales for the SMB.
